Abstract

This study aims to calculate the economic value of biogas volume and analyze the efficiency of its use as a substitute for the use of firewood and kerosene in the byo energy of pig farmers' kitchens. This research was conducted in Pitak Village, Langke Rembong District, Manggarai Regency, East Nusa Tenggara Province during December 2022. The treatment tried was P0: Fermentation of pig feces for 6 days; P1: Fermentation of pig feces for 12 days; P2: Fermentation of pig feces for 18 days; P3: Fermentation of feces of pigs for 24 days. The variables studied are the calculation of the economic value of the volume of biogas produced after undergoing the fermentation process and calculating the efficiency value of using biogas with firewood and kerosene. The efficiency value of using biogas is calculated based on the results of conversion with kerosene and firewood is to produce gas that can be used to cook one liter of water is 21,473.45 ml so that it is equivalent to the use of kerosene for cooking 1 liter of water is 280 ml of kerosene for IDR. 6,500 and the use of firewood needed as much as 0.5 kg (1 bunch) for 0.5 kg or one bunch of firewood equivalent to IDR. 5,000. The results of the analysis can be concluded that, the most economical volume of biogas is P1 treatment with a fermentation duration on the 12th day with gas produced as much as 21,067.37 ml and a percentage of 57.55% and the estimated value of benefits or marginal value as much as 4,657.21 by being used to cook as much as 21,473.45 ml of water for 7.19 minutes.
